Lead Senior Software Engineer, Agentic AI Applications

at Nvidia
USD 184,000-356,500 per year
SENIOR
βœ… On-site

SCRAPED

Used Tools & Technologies

Not specified

Required Skills & Competences ?

Go @ 4 Kafka @ 6 Python @ 7 Data Science @ 4 Leadership @ 4 Communication @ 6 Mentoring @ 4 Performance Optimization @ 4 LLM @ 4 CUDA @ 3 GPU @ 3

Details

NVIDIA is seeking a Senior Software Engineer to serve as a Tech Lead, driving the design and delivery of agentic blueprints and reference workflows (including the AI-Q Deep Researcher blueprint). The role focuses on creating agentic reference applications that demonstrate how enterprises can implement agentic AI at scale, translating research and prototypes into robust, scalable, and maintainable systems, and mentoring others.

Responsibilities

  • Design, develop, and implement agentic AI blueprints (applications) that show enterprises how to utilize and deploy agentic AI.
  • Lead technical reviews and provide mentorship to engineering teams building production-grade workflows and extending GenAI SDK capabilities.
  • Develop proof-of-concept workflows rooted in first principles using modern data science techniques for GenAI use cases.
  • Collaborate cross-functionally with product, research, and infrastructure teams to evolve NVIDIA's agentic ecosystem, including integrations between the NeMo Agent Toolkit and other NVIDIA products and services (NeMo Framework, NIMs, NVIDIA Blueprints).
  • Drive performance optimization for agentic applications across the data center, improving accuracy, reducing latency, and increasing efficiency.
  • Establish engineering standards and best practices for developing, testing, and deploying agentic AI applications across distributed environments.

Requirements

  • BS in Computer Engineering, Computer Science, Data Science, or a related field, or equivalent experience; MS or PhD preferred.
  • 8+ years of software engineering experience, including 2+ years as a tech lead.
  • Proficient in Python, with at least 6+ years building Python libraries or applications for enterprise customers.
  • Experience with GenAI application development using LLM frameworks (examples: LangChain, LlamaIndex, AutoGen), evaluation systems (e.g., RAGAs), and observability platforms (e.g., Arize Phoenix, Weights & Biases, LangSmith).
  • Experience using and understanding agentic frameworks.
  • Proficient in distributed orchestration and communication frameworks (examples: Kafka, Ray).
  • Ability to quickly learn and apply new technologies and libraries.
  • Self-starter able to work independently and within a distributed team; strong communication and collaboration skills across distributed, cross-functional teams.

Ways to stand out

  • Demonstrated leadership in building and scaling agentic AI applications in production.
  • Experience developing your own agents in Python or a similar language (e.g., Go).
  • Concrete examples/code of profiling and mitigating performance bottlenecks.
  • Experience developing for GPU platforms and familiarity with NVIDIA technologies (CUDA, TensorRT, Triton, NeMo) and LLM serving frameworks (Dynamo, vLLM, SGLang).
  • Experience with RAG systems and communication protocols (e.g., MCP, A2A).

Compensation & Application

  • Base salary range for Level 4: 184,000 USD - 287,500 USD.
  • Base salary range for Level 5: 224,000 USD - 356,500 USD.
  • You will also be eligible for equity and benefits.
  • Applications for this job will be accepted at least until January 16, 2026.

Company & Equal Opportunity

  • NVIDIA highlights its use of AI tools in recruiting processes.
  • NVIDIA is committed to fostering a diverse work environment and is an equal opportunity employer. The company does not discriminate based on protected characteristics.